Section A — Multiple Choice Questions
5 × 1 = 5 marks
1.
$|3\hat i+4\hat j|=$
- A.$5$
- B.$7$
- C.$12$
- D.$25$
2.
The unit vector along $2\hat i+3\hat j+6\hat k$ is $\tfrac1k(2\hat i+3\hat j+6\hat k)$ with $k=$
- A.$5$
- B.$7$
- C.$11$
- D.$49$
3.
$\overrightarrow{AB}$ equals:
- A.$\vec a+\vec b$
- B.$\vec b-\vec a$
- C.$\vec a-\vec b$
- D.$\tfrac{\vec a+\vec b}{2}$
4.
A unit vector has magnitude:
- A.$0$
- B.$1$
- C.any value
- D.$\sqrt2$
5.
The position vector of $P(x,y,z)$ is:
- A.$x+y+z$
- B.$x\hat i+y\hat j+z\hat k$
- C.$\sqrt{x^2+y^2+z^2}$
- D.$xyz$
Section B — Short Answer (2 marks)
4 × 2 = 8 marks
6.
Find $|\hat i-2\hat j+2\hat k|$.
7.
Find the unit vector along $3\hat i+4\hat k$.
8.
Find $\overrightarrow{AB}$ for $A(1,2,3),\ B(4,6,3)$.
9.
Are $2\hat i+4\hat j$ and $\hat i+2\hat j$ parallel?
Section C — Short Answer (3 marks)
4 × 3 = 12 marks
10.
Find the unit vector along $2\hat i+3\hat j+6\hat k$.
11.
Find the midpoint of $A(2,0,4)$ and $B(0,2,0)$ as a position vector.
12.
Find a vector of magnitude $10$ along $3\hat i+4\hat j$.
13.
Find the point dividing $A(1,2,3),\ B(4,5,6)$ in the ratio $2:1$.
Section D — Long Answer (5 marks)
2 × 5 = 10 marks
14.
Find a unit vector in the direction of the sum of $\hat i+2\hat j-\hat k$ and $2\hat i+\hat j+\hat k$.
15.
Show that the points $A(1,2,3),\ B(2,3,4),\ C(3,4,5)$ are collinear.
